know your car” chapter.UNDERSTANDING TYRE
MARKINGLoad rating
60 =250 kg85 =515 kg
61 =257 kg86 =530 kg
62 =265 kg87 =545 kg
63 =272 kg88 =560 kg
64 =280 kg89 =580 kg
65 =290 kg90 =600 kg
66 =300 kg91 =615 kg
67 =307 kg92 =630 kg
68 =315 kg93 =650 kg
69 =325 kg94 =670 kg
70 =335 kg95 =690 kg
71 =345 kg96 =710 kg
72 =355 kg97 =730 kg
73 =365 kg98 =750 kg
74 =375 kg99 =775 kg
75 =387 kg100 =800 kg
76 =400 kg101 =825 kg
77 =412 kg102 =850 kg
78 =425 kg103 =875 kg
79 =437 kg104 =900 kg
80 =450 kg105 =925 kg
81 =462 kg106 =950 kg
82 =
475 kg
83 =487 kg
84 =500 kg Example: 205/65 R 15 94 H
205 =Nominal width (distance be-
tween bodysides in mm).
65 =Height/width percentage ratio.
R =Radial tyre.
15 =Rim diameter (in inches).
94 =Load rating.
H =Maximum speed rating.

Maximum speed index
Q =up to 160 km/h
R =up to 170 km/h
S =up to 180 km/h
T =up to 190 km/h
U =up to 200 km/h
H =up to 210 km/h
V =over 210 km/h
ZR =over 240 km/h
W =up to 270 km/h
Y =up to 300 km/h.
Maximum speed rating
for snow tyres
Q M + S =up to 160 km/h.
T M + S =up to 190 km/h.
H M + S =up to 210 km/h.UNDERSTANDING RIM
